Almost half the children who undergo kidney transplantation (KTx) have congenital abnormalities of the kidney and urinary tract (CAKUT). We compared patient, graft survival, and kidney function at last follow‐up between CAKUT and non‐CAKUT patients after KTx. We divided the analysis into two eras: 1988‐2000 and 2001‐2019. Of 923 patients, 52% had CAKUT and 48% non‐CAKUT chronic kidney disease (CKD)...
